What Are Energy Performance Certificates?
EPCs (Energy Performance Certificates) are official documents that assess a property's energy efficiency on a scale from A (most efficient) to G (least efficient). They are legally required when selling, letting, or constructing a new home in the Caterham. EPCs help residents and investors understand how much it will cost to run and maintain the property—and how to improve energy performance through practical suggestions.
Why Energy Performance Certificates Matter
Energy Performance Certificates are not just legal formalities—they’re practical tools for cutting utility bills. With rising utility costs and growing eco-consciousness, EPCs offer key data on energy efficiency. The suggestions provided in the certificate can lead to significant efficiency improvements by improving insulation, installing modern boilers, or using LED lighting and eco-friendly devices.
